News summary

Kaja Kallas, the EU's High Representative for Foreign Affairs and Security Policy, asserted that the European Union is prepared to assume leadership in military support for Ukraine if the United States withdraws its commitment. Speaking ahead of a meeting with allies in Ramstein, Germany, Kallas expressed confidence that the U.S. would maintain its support, emphasizing that it is not in America's interest for Russia to emerge as the dominant global power. Kallas highlighted the readiness of EU members to continue backing Ukraine and stressed the importance of solidarity among allies. Her statements reflect a shift from previous comments by former EU diplomat Josep Borrell, who suggested Europe could not fill the gap in support. As the political landscape shifts with the upcoming inauguration of Donald Trump, Kallas remains optimistic about transatlantic cooperation.
